The Fox Chapel area real estate market has maintained steady activity as we move through the summer of 2026. This report highlights key property transactions from the week of July 6, providing a snapshot of the current local market pulse.

Breaking Down Neighborhood Performance
Aspinwall remains a sought-after location, evidenced by a recent sale on Center Avenue for $190,000. Meanwhile, Indiana Township saw consistent interest with properties on Saxonburg Boulevard and Voskamp Drive changing hands for $125,000 and $133,210, respectively.

Focus on O’Hara and Sharpsburg Activity
O’Hara stood out as the most active area during this reporting period, boasting five significant transactions. This level of volume typically suggests a healthy inventory flow and buyer confidence in the area.
The sales in O’Hara ranged across various price brackets, indicating a broad appeal for the neighborhood:
- Fox Chapel Road: Properties sold for $290,000 and $495,000.
- Glengary Drive: A property was recorded at $280,000.
- Kittanning Pike: A sale closed at $537,450.
- Westchester Place: This property changed hands for $659,900.

Commercial and Residential Shifts in Sharpsburg
Sharpsburg also recorded notable activity, with two significant sales involving properties on 22nd Street and Main Street. These assets were acquired for $199,900 and $667,318, respectively, showcasing a mix of investment types.
